logo

Output dd2b89144aa657d5bfd91bcfa111ba2f55b96beb83dd6bf65cfb4febf4aab299:201

value
150770993
script pubkey
OP_0 OP_PUSHBYTES_20 54bdd55f88e1a38f0b2f3946699bf47f44a3e078
address
bc1q2j7a2hugux3c7ze089rxnxl50az28crca3nddl
transaction
dd2b89144aa657d5bfd91bcfa111ba2f55b96beb83dd6bf65cfb4febf4aab299